随着信息技术的飞速发展,企业对于业务流程管理的需求日益增长。传统的软件开发模式往往周期长、成本高,难以满足快速变化的市场需求。而低代码开发平台的出现,为企业业务流程管理带来了新的变革。本文将深入探讨低代码开发平台的工作原理、优势以及如何重塑企业业务流程管理新纪元。
一、低代码开发平台概述
1.1 定义
低代码开发平台(Low-Code Development Platform,简称LCDP)是一种可视化的软件开发工具,它允许用户通过拖拽组件、配置属性等方式快速构建应用程序,而无需深入了解编程语言和开发框架。
1.2 发展背景
随着移动互联、大数据、云计算等技术的普及,企业对业务流程管理的要求越来越高。传统的软件开发模式已经无法满足快速迭代、低成本、高效率的需求。低代码开发平台的兴起,正是为了解决这一问题。
二、低代码开发平台的工作原理
2.1 基本原理
低代码开发平台的核心是可视化的开发界面,用户可以通过拖拽组件、配置属性等方式快速构建应用程序。平台内部通过自动化脚本和配置文件,将用户的设计转化为可执行的应用程序。
2.2 技术架构
低代码开发平台通常采用以下技术架构:
- 前端技术:HTML、CSS、JavaScript等;
- 后端技术:Java、Python、Node.js等;
- 数据库技术:MySQL、MongoDB、Oracle等;
- 中间件技术:消息队列、缓存、负载均衡等。
三、低代码开发平台的优势
3.1 简化开发流程
低代码开发平台将复杂的编程任务转化为可视化的操作,极大地简化了开发流程,降低了开发难度。
3.2 提高开发效率
通过低代码开发平台,开发人员可以快速构建应用程序,缩短开发周期,提高开发效率。
3.3 降低开发成本
低代码开发平台降低了开发门槛,使得非技术人员也能参与到应用开发中,从而降低了人力成本。
3.4 适应性强
低代码开发平台支持多种业务场景,能够满足企业多样化的业务需求。
四、低代码开发平台在业务流程管理中的应用
4.1 工作流自动化
低代码开发平台可以将复杂的业务流程转化为可视化的工作流,实现自动化处理,提高工作效率。
4.2 数据集成
低代码开发平台可以轻松实现与其他系统集成,如ERP、CRM等,实现数据共享和业务协同。
4.3 移动办公
低代码开发平台支持移动端应用开发,方便员工随时随地处理业务,提高办公效率。
五、低代码开发平台的发展趋势
5.1 技术融合
未来,低代码开发平台将与其他技术(如人工智能、大数据等)深度融合,为企业提供更智能的业务流程管理解决方案。
5.2 开放生态
低代码开发平台将构建开放生态,吸引更多开发者参与,推动平台功能的不断完善。
5.3 个性化定制
低代码开发平台将更加注重个性化定制,满足企业多样化的业务需求。
六、总结
低代码开发平台作为一种新兴的软件开发模式,为企业业务流程管理带来了新的变革。随着技术的不断发展和完善,低代码开发平台将在未来发挥越来越重要的作用,助力企业实现数字化转型。
